Proposed development
Permission for construction of one additional parking space and for associated works, and also for retention of (i) change of front ground floor windows to double doors, & (ii) retention of external raised decking area
What happens next
Permission was granted on 11 Oct 2024. Third parties may appeal within four weeks; after that the permission is final and works can start once a commencement notice is lodged.
